Are wheels and rims the same thing?

Many people use the terms wheel and rim interchangeably, but the two are not the same. In fact, the rim is one of several parts that make up the wheel. It is the outside edge of the wheel where the tire sits. … The term rim is often used to refer to after-market or decorative wheels, such as aluminum alloy wheels.

What does offset mean on wheels?

Offset refers to how your car’s or truck’s wheels and tires are mounted and sit in the wheel wells. … Positive wheel offset is when the hub mounting surface is in front (more toward the street side) of the centerline of the wheel. Most wheels on front-wheel drive cars and newer rear-drive vehicles have positive offset.

Why are wheels true?

So to keep your bike rolling smoothly and safely, it’s important to maintain straight and warp-free wheels by truing them from time to time. Truing a wheel involves tightening and loosening the spoke nipples to realign warped sections of the rim, and it’s something you can do at home.
